Definitions: Manual Therapy is therapy done with the hands, primarly massage and manipulation. Bodywork is hands-on therapy that harmonizes and aligns the structure of the body, but can also help physiological and psychological function. This can include various forms of structural therapy, massage, energy healing, and movement therapy. Adjunctive Therapies are treatments that support and enhance the primary treatment. Soft Tissue Manipulation is the skillful use of the hands to restore mobility and reduce strain in soft tissues of the body such as muscles, ligaments, tendons, and connective tissue.
